ADO.NET: The Complete Reference

ADO.NET: The Complete Reference pdf epub mobi txt 电子书 下载 2026

出版者:McGraw-Hill Osborne Media
作者:Michael OteyDenielle Otey
出品人:
页数:0
译者:
出版时间:2003-03-01
价格:424.9
装帧:
isbn号码:9780072228984
丛书系列:
图书标签:
  • NET
  • ADO
  • NET
  • 数据库
  • 数据访问
  • C#
  • SQL Server
  • 数据处理
  • 编程
  • 开发
  • 参考书
想要找书就要到 小美书屋
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

Make the most of your development time and efforts with the only complete desktop reference to the entire ADO.NET framework. This comprehensive resource covers all ADO.NET objects and presents example

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

我购买这本书的初衷,很大程度上是源于对旧有遗留系统的维护压力。这些系统大量依赖于早期的 ADO.NET 模式,涉及到大量的 `DbCommandBuilder` 的复杂使用和行数据修改(Row Updating)的自定义逻辑。我需要一本可以作为“字典”来查阅每一个 ADO.NET 对象的生命周期、事件模型以及异常处理机制的权威指南。例如,关于 `IDataReader` 的前向只读特性,如何巧妙地利用它在处理大型结果集时不将所有数据一次性载入内存的技巧,是编写高效数据流处理器的基础。此外,我对数据类型转换的细微差别非常感兴趣——从数据库特定的类型(如 `SQLVariant` 或特定的地理空间类型)如何安全、无损地映射到 .NET 类型,以及当数据类型不匹配时,框架内部抛出的异常链是如何构成的。如果书中能详细列举在不同 OLE DB 提供程序和原生客户端驱动程序之间的细微差异,并提供跨平台访问数据的通用接口设计模式,那它就真正配得上“参考”二字。我需要的是那种,当我在凌晨三点修复一个奇怪的连接超时问题时,能迅速定位到问题的根源,而不是在官方文档的海洋中迷失方向的工具书。

评分

这本厚重的书摆在我桌上,光是掂量分量就知道作者在上面下了多少功夫。我一直都在寻找一本能够彻底、深入地剖析.NET 数据访问技术,尤其是 ADO.NET 框架的书籍,因为市面上很多资料要么太零散,要么停留在基础的 CRUD 操作层面,对于像我这样需要处理复杂数据交互、高性能需求和分布式事务的开发者来说,简直是杯水车薪。我原本期望它能详尽地讲解 DataSet、DataTable 的内部工作机制,尤其是它们在内存管理和数据同步方面的陷阱和最佳实践。此外,对于如何有效地利用 SQL Server 存储过程、自定义数据适配器,乃至于异步数据操作(Async/Await)在数据访问层中的应用,这些高级话题,是衡量一本“参考大全”是否名副其实的关键标准。我特别期待看到关于连接池管理、事务隔离级别对性能的具体影响,以及如何在不同版本的 .NET Framework 乃至 Core 框架下,平滑地迁移和优化现有的数据访问层代码。如果这本书能提供足够多的企业级应用案例,展示如何在海量数据读写场景中榨干每一滴性能,那它绝对是物超所值。我需要的不只是语法手册,而是能指导我构建健壮、高效数据系统的实战宝典。

评分

说实话,当我翻开这本书的目录时,那种扑面而来的信息量让我既兴奋又有点发怵。我尤其关注其中关于 LINQ to SQL 和 Entity Framework 早期版本的深度对比分析。在我的实际项目中,团队内部对于何时应该坚持使用裸露的 ADO.NET 命令对象,何时应该拥抱 ORM 框架,一直争论不休。我需要这本书能提供一个清晰、基于性能测试和维护成本的决策框架,而不是简单地推荐“最新的技术”。我希望它能细致入微地剖析 ORM 框架在 N+1 查询问题、延迟加载(Lazy Loading)的性能陷阱,以及如何通过自定义查询翻译器来优化复杂关联查询的内部机制。对于面向对象的数据映射部分,我渴望看到关于值对象(Value Objects)和实体身份(Entity Identity)在数据持久化过程中如何保持一致性的深入探讨。如果书中能提供关于如何使用 Code First 模式进行数据库演进管理的详尽指南,并讨论迁移过程中的数据安全性和回滚策略,那对我接下来的架构设计工作将是巨大的助力。我期待的不是肤浅的教程,而是能够武装我的思维、让我能够自信地为项目选择技术栈的深度分析。

评分

对于任何一个严肃的数据库开发者来说,性能调优和安全性是永恒的主题。我非常期望这本书能够深入探讨数据访问层的安全漏洞,特别是 SQL 注入(SQL Injection)的防御,不仅仅停留在参数化查询的层面,而是深入到如何构建一个完全不可被用户输入污染的动态 SQL 生成器。在并发控制方面,我期待看到如何利用数据库层面的乐观锁和悲观锁机制,结合 ADO.NET 的事务管理,来实现高并发环境下的数据一致性。这需要对 `IsolationLevel` 的深入理解,以及如何有效地使用 `DbTransaction` 对象来确保操作的原子性。我尤其关注关于大对象(LOB,如 `BLOB`/`CLOB`)的流式处理技术,如何避免将整个大文件加载到应用层内存中,而是通过流直接写入或读取,这对于处理媒体文件或大型文本记录至关重要。如果书中能提供关于如何使用跨域(Cross-Domain)或跨进程的数据访问策略的章节,讨论其性能权衡和安全性考量,那么这本书的价值将得到几何级的提升。它应该教会我如何构建一个既快速又滴水不漏的数据访问基础设施。

评分

我一直对数据架构的演进历史和未来趋势抱有浓厚兴趣。一本全面的参考书,理应提供一个历史的纵深视角,让我理解 ADO.NET 是如何一步步演变而来,并承载了过去二十年间 .NET 生态系统的变化。我希望书中能够用一种比较的眼光,系统地对比 WCF Data Services(如果有涉及)与现代 Web API/gRPC 在数据契约和传输效率上的差异。更重要的是,我希望看到作者对未来数据访问范式的思考——例如,如何将异步/响应式编程模型(如 Reactive Extensions)更优雅地融入到传统的数据访问管道中,实现真正意义上的非阻塞数据操作。对于缓存策略的讨论也必不可少,如何集成分布式缓存(如 Redis)到数据访问层,并设计一套有效的缓存失效策略,以减轻对主数据库的压力。如果这本书能够超越纯粹的技术实现,上升到架构哲学层面,指导开发者如何根据业务场景选择最合适的持久化技术栈,那么它就不只是一本编程指南,而是一部领域内的思想结晶。

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.quotespace.org All Rights Reserved. 小美书屋 版权所有